GCAVU responds to LLRSU

Dimapur, Feb 25 (MExN): The Governors Camp Area Village Union (GCAVU) has stated in a release that it was appalled on how the LLRSU had warned the Union and the organization for giving co-operation and support to the Border Magistrates in carrying out their assigned work in safeguarding and protecting the land and the people of the Nagas living in the DAB and that the GCAVU is not at all deterred by such warning of the LLRSU.

The joint release issued by Yihamo Tungoe, Secretary and N. Zankhomo Ovung, Chairman stated that while it appeared that the Government of Assam, LLRSU and LSU were in favour of withdrawing the resolution adopted at Border Magistrate level meeting at BOP Rengmapani on the November 9, 2005 and the subsequent circular issued by the Border Magistrate Uriamghat, Nagaland, the GCAVU fails to understand what actually transpired among LLRSU, LSU and the government of Assam, pressing for withdrawal of the same.

“If LLRSU ever had such concern for the land, it should have first tried to know the area where such adoption of resolution was required. It was embarrassing on the part of the LLRSU to have warned the Border Magistrate Uriamghat, Nagaland even without giving a single visit to the area and the people and that if the LLRSU was so concerned the organization should have met the Border Magistrate in question and discussed the issues before going to the press with all never ever heard derogatory and intimidating words which were very unpleasant for any upcoming decent society”, it stated.

The release stated that if the LLRSU was really serious in solving the problems of the people living in the area in question, they have been requested to visit the area, the people and also meet the Border Magistrates.“The LLRSU is directed to come out with detail facts and figures as to how much land has been sold out by those individuals and Unions alleged by the LLRSU to have been ’hand in glove’ with SDO (C) Ralan cum Border Magistrate Uriamghat, Nagaland”, it added.
